Ramer - Bro Samuel Ramer was born in Crawford Co Ohio, Nov 24, 1840; died at his home near Versailles, Mo, May 3, 1917; aged 76 y, 5 m, 9 d.

April 25, 1878, he was united in marriage with Annie Reed of Nappanee, Ind. To this union 5 sons (one of whom died in infancy), and 1 daughter were born.

He is survived by his companion, 4 sons, 1 daughter and 2 grandchildren.

At the age of 21 he united with the Mennonite Church and remained a loyal, faithful member until death. Funeral services at Mt Zion Church, May 6, conducted by Bros Amos Gingerich and D F Driver. Text, "I have fought a good fight, I have finished my course." Interment in adjoining cemetery. Peace to his ashes. His soul is at rest.

Gospel Herald
Vol X, No 8
24 May 1917
